NordVPN is a virtual private network launched in 2012 and operated out of Panama, aimed at anyone who wants to encrypt their connection, change their virtual location, or browse with less exposure on public Wi-Fi. It works for everyday use — streaming, P2P downloads, remote work — as well as slightly more technical needs, thanks to features such as a kill switch, split tunnelling, Double VPN servers and Meshnet, and it lets a single account protect up to ten devices.
The network now runs more than 8,000 servers across 225 locations, with NordLynx — its WireGuard variant with post-quantum encryption — and NordWhisper as the main protocols, alongside OpenVPN and IKEv2/IPSec for manual setups. Its no-logs policy has been independently reviewed several times: by PricewaterhouseCoopers AG Switzerland in 2018 and 2020, and by Deloitte in the years since. It accepts payment in Bitcoin, Ethereum, Litecoin and stablecoins, alongside cards and PayPal, and offers a 30-day money-back guarantee.
The fine print is worth reading before paying. The advertised starting price applies to the two-year Basic plan and renews afterwards at $139.08 a year. That Basic plan also excludes the antivirus, ad blocker and password manager that NordVPN highlights elsewhere on its site — those require the Complete plan — and a dedicated IP is only available on the priciest tier. And while the service is operated out of Panama, a country with no data-retention laws that would apply to it, the group's parent company, Nord Security, is corporately headquartered in Lithuania, a nuance worth keeping in mind.
